Position Overview:
Assists with the accurate and timely processing of bi-weekly, multi-state payroll process for hourly and salaried employees. Utilizing the Human Capital Management (HCM) system ensures compliance across multiple states and with federal wage and hour laws.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S
Education:High school diploma or GED.
Experience:Two years of payroll processing experience.
Other Credentials:
Knowledge and Skills:Maintains an understanding of payroll laws and regulations. Possesses excellent organizational, verbal and written communications skills with an emphasis on customer service. Related payroll certifications preferred.
Special Training:Basic knowledge with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ook. Workday experience preferred.
Mental, Behavioral and Emotional Abilities:Ability to maintain confidentiality of payroll/employee information. Highly motivated and able to work in a fast-paced environment.
Usual Work Day:8 Hours
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
- Works with multiple departments to verify hours worked, paid time off, deductions, and pay adjustments. Escalates more complex processes to Sr. Payroll Specialist.
- Assists with all aspects of the payroll process.
- Assists with monitoring of time and attendance integration files from vendor into HCM. Escalates and communicates critical issues accordingly.
- Assists with reviewing payroll inputs from various sources to minimize errors. Collects, reviews, calculates, and assures accurate processing of payroll data.
- Coordinates state and federal filings with external third-party vendors Calculates and processes payroll adjustments, such as wage garnishments.
- Assists with providing excellent customer service by addressing concerns, resolving issues, and offering guidance on payroll matters while maintaining a professional demeanor.
- Processes and audits employee transactions such as new hires, terminations, employee changes, and other related transactions.
- Maintains an accurate knowledge of CH policies and government regulations regarding payroll.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
